Rangitoto
General Information
The hexadecimal color code #312C21, often referred to as Rangitoto, is a dark, subdued shade of brown, evoking a sense of earthiness and grounding. It is composed of 19.22% red, 17.25% green, and 12.94% blue. In the RGB color space, it is a relatively desaturated color, contributing to its muted and sophisticated appearance. This color lends itself well to creating a calm and stable visual environment. In the CMYK color model, it consists of 0% cyan, 10% magenta, 33% yellow, and 81% black. The name 'Rangitoto' possibly references the Rangitoto Island, a volcanic island near Auckland, New Zealand, which shares a similar dark, earthy tone. The color #312C21, also known as Rangitoto, presents some accessibility challenges, particularly concerning color contrast. When used as a background color, it necessitates light-colored text to ensure readability. A contrast ratio of at least 4.5:1 is recommended for standard text and 3:1 for large text to meet WCAG (Web Content Accessibility Guidelines) AA standards. Insufficient contrast can make content difficult or impossible to read for users with visual impairments. Tools like contrast checkers can help determine if the color combination meets accessibility standards. Consideration should also be given to users with color blindness, as certain color pairings might not be distinguishable. Implementing proper ARIA labels and semantic HTML can further enhance accessibility, providing alternative ways for users to understand content regardless of color perception.
